| This is probably an issue with your burner software. From your description, I'm assuming you are using some packet writer like DirectCD ("Drag to Disk") or InCD or similar. It certainly isn't a function of Money since Money knows nothing about writable optical devices. | I have been backing up my Money 2001 to a CDRW. (It was taking too many floppies) Recently, though, once I back up the CD will not eject from the machine. I manually remove it but when checking the F. drive, it shows that the information is still there. It remains there until I shut down and start up the computer again Note: This did not happen before and I was backing up successfully onto the same CD for a while. It just started doing this the past month or so. I attempted to do a new back up CD (in case there was a problem with the CD itself) and the first time I backed up there was not problem but when I put it in for a new back up to the same CD, it would not eject as stated above Does anybody know why this is happending |
